Back in the day before the WPT even existed..... Card Player asked Mike Sexton to write a column. He thought long and hard about whether he wanted to write or not. Mike's a smart guy and he knew that writing about poker was pretty much always -EV. Sure he would get paid..... but not a whole helluva lot..... and the information that he disseminated couldnt ever help him at all. So, he came to a pretty reasonable compromise in his own mind. He would go ahead and agree to write a column, but he would NEVER write about poker strategy of any kind, whatsoever. Hed write about places he went to play poker...... people he played poker with........ or anything related to his life around poker, but he wouldnt ever write a strategy column.

Well, millions of dollars and a stable family life tend to change our outlook after a while, lol...... but i think that the thought process is sound on its face. And you would imagine that anyone talking to Mike at that point would have encouraged him to PLEASE not stop writing. Even if he wrote nine columns about Stuey and ten columns about being in the military and eleven columns about the burgeoning TOC....... if he wrote even one strategy column in the midst of the thirty others.... i would imagine it wouldve been encouraged from a guy who had so much knowledge to share.

Meanwhile, he was getting PAID to write, lol.

Mike's a smart guy. Think about where poker would be now a days without guys like Mike Sexton, Henry Orenstein, or Mori Eskandani. Crazy.
